dibs
Meaning
-
The right to use or enjoy something exclusively or before anyone else.

Etymology
Since the early 19th century, of disputed origin. Most commonly thought to be from dibstones (“counters used in a game with the same name”). Also from dib (“to tap”) or related to northern English dip (“small depression in the ground”), or a shortened version of divide.
